Using a beat that seems to have the same undertone as the hit "CoCo," O.T. Genasis manages to top the heat factor with the new track titled "Ricky."

Like "CoCo," "Ricky" is most certainly inspired by that white. Today HotNewHipHop premiered the brand new banger from Genasis and it's definitely sounding as if it's going to take the radio by storm.

Genasis is a lot more vocal with the track rather then his slow rhyme that was used on the first track, he flexes his lyrical style that fans know he possesses.

"The Busta Rhymes-signed rapper returned the other week with a loose cut, 'The Flyest,' and today he gives HNHH the premiere of his official single, 'Ricky,'" reported HotNewHipHop.

Despite having a heavy similarity to "CoCo," fans will still enjoy the catchy nature of the song.

The repetitive hook makes for something that is for lack of better terms "so bad it's good." Genasis may be able to get away with a similar song for now and "Ricky" will most likely see a pretty long line of rappers lining up to jump on the remix, however, it would be nice to see a little diversity from Genasis.
